Output 599a2858b4e38b3872aaa81d53731246a88b64c40f6e1a41eff2954bbfa351c9:0

value
433109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ecca038bae476bd0d4ab5b1f684f6e76b46b436f OP_EQUAL
address
3PH3Pz2o8p42qZeBUMYpmy28bKkmhpWfPw
transaction
599a2858b4e38b3872aaa81d53731246a88b64c40f6e1a41eff2954bbfa351c9
spent
true